Remarks | My son and I were fishing facing North with a high river bank in front of us. A very bright light lit the whole side of the river bank we were facing. We thought someone was shining a flash light at us. We quickly turned to the south and saw a green/blue/white light streaking from the east to the west. The light was low in the sky and we only saw it for maybe a second. It had to last 2-3 seconds for us to react, turn around, and still see the streaking light. We thought someone had shot a roman candle but there was no sound, no other lights, and at an angle not associated with a roman candle. I've searched news articles to see if there were any other reports but have found nothing. The time I listed is approximate since we did not have a watch with us at the time. |
